Discuss the role of the Knights Templar during the Crusades.

The Knights Templar played a crucial role during the Crusades as a military order protecting Christian pilgrims and fighting against Muslims.

The Knights Templar, officially known as the Poor Fellow-Soldiers of Christ and of the Temple of Solomon, were a unique combination of knight and monk, established around 1119 CE. They were initially formed to ensure the safety of Christian pilgrims travelling to the Holy Land during the time of the Crusades. The Templars were recognised for their white mantles adorned with a red cross, a symbol that became synonymous with their order.

Their role expanded beyond mere protection of pilgrims. The Templars became a standing army in the Holy Land, participating in many major battles of the Crusades, including the pivotal Battle of Hattin in 1187. They were renowned for their fierce fighting skills and strict code of conduct, inspired by the Cistercian Order. Their military prowess was instrumental in holding onto Christian territories and fortifications in the Middle East.

The Templars also played a significant role in the financial operations of the time. They developed an early form of banking, providing loans and safekeeping for pilgrims' valuables. This financial acumen led to the Templars amassing considerable wealth and influence, which eventually contributed to their downfall.

However, their influence waned after the loss of the Holy Land. Accusations of heresy, largely driven by King Philip IV of France who was heavily in debt to the Templars, led to their disbandment in 1312. Despite their controversial end, the Knights Templar's role during the Crusades was undeniably significant, shaping the course of the conflicts and leaving a lasting legacy in the history of the Christian and Muslim worlds.
